The inherent properties of 304 stainless steel, including its superior resistance to corrosion, oxidation, and a wide range of chemicals, make it ideal for environments exposed to moisture, corrosive substances, or elevated temperatures. This material's high tensile strength and formability allow for precise customization to meet specific engineering requirements in applications such as heavy-duty shelving, industrial platforms, custom conveyor components, and structural supports within material processing plants.

| Tensile Strength | 75,000 psi (515 MPa) |
| Yield Strength | 30,000 psi (205 MPa) |
| Elongation in 2 in. | 40% min |
| Hardness | Rockwell B95 max |
| Carbon (C) | 0.08% max |
| Chromium (Cr) | 18.0 - 20.0% |
| Nickel (Ni) | 8.0 - 10.5% |
| Manganese (Mn) | 2.00% max |
